Introduction to the Lenovo T430
The Lenovo T430 is part of the ThinkPad series, a line of laptops designed for business and professional use. Released in 2012, the T430 was praised for its durability, long battery life, and impressive performance given its time. It features a 14-inch display, making it a compact and portable option for those who need a reliable laptop for work or personal projects. Camera Specifications and Availability
When it comes to the camera, the Lenovo T430 does indeed come equipped with a built-in camera. This camera is located at the top of the screen, centered above the display, which is a common placement for laptop cameras. The camera’s primary function is to facilitate video conferencing and online meetings, making it an essential tool for business users and remote workers. However, the quality and specifications of the camera can vary.
The Lenovo T430’s camera is typically a 720p HD camera, capable of capturing decent quality video and images. While it may not offer the highest resolution compared to newer laptop models, it is sufficient for standard video conferencing needs. It’s also worth noting that the camera’s performance can be influenced by the lighting conditions and the software used to capture or stream video.

Can I disable the camera on my Lenovo T430?
Yes, you can disable the camera on your Lenovo T430 if you do not want to use it or if you are concerned about privacy. To disable the camera, you can use the Lenovo Settings app or the Device Manager. In the Lenovo Settings app, you can click on the camera icon and then click on the “Disable” button to turn off the camera. In the Device Manager, you can find the camera device under the “Imaging Devices” section and then right-click on it to select the “Disable device” option.
Disabling the camera on your Lenovo T430 can provide an additional layer of security and privacy, especially if you are using the laptop in a public place or if you are concerned about unauthorized access to the camera. However, keep in mind that disabling the camera will prevent you from using it for video conferencing, taking photos, and other purposes. If you need to use the camera again, you can simply enable it using the same steps. It’s also worth noting that some applications may not function properly if the camera is disabled, so you may need to enable it to use certain apps.
How do I update the camera driver on my Lenovo T430?
To update the camera driver on your Lenovo T430, you can use the Lenovo Support website or the Device Manager. On the Lenovo Support website, you can search for the latest camera driver for your laptop model and then download and install it. In the Device Manager, you can find the camera device under the “Imaging Devices” section and then right-click on it to select the “Update driver” option. This will search for and install any available updates for the camera driver.
Updating the camera driver on your Lenovo T430 can help to improve the performance and functionality of the camera. It can also fix any issues or errors that you may be experiencing with the camera, such as poor image quality or failure to detect the camera. To ensure that you have the latest camera driver, it’s a good idea to check for updates regularly. You can also use the Lenovo System Update tool to automatically detect and install any available updates for your laptop, including the camera driver.
